Use local SEO

One of the most important things you can do to help your brick-and-mortar store succeed is to use local SEO. With local SEO, you can target potential customers in your area who are looking for a store like yours. This will help you to increase foot traffic and sales.

There are many things you can do to improve your local SEO. Make sure your business is listed on Google My Business (GMB) and other local directories. Post high-quality content about your store and its products on your website and social media. And participate in local events and networking groups to get your name out there.

By using local SEO, you can help your brick-and-mortar store thrive in today’s competitive retail landscape!

Increase foot traffic by offering incentives

Offering unique incentives like gift wrapping, refreshments, or free Wi-Fi can attract more customers to your brick-and-mortar store. People love getting something for free and these sorts of services can help elevate the customer experience in your store.

You can also increase foot traffic by hosting fun events in your store. These events can include everything from book signings to Christmas parties. You could even hold a raffle for a free iPad Mini or dinner with the CEO of the company! Special events like these will attract customers who might not have stopped into your business otherwise, and increased foot traffic can equate to increased revenues.

Enhance your store with creative window displays

When people drive or walk by a store, they often look at the windows. Your windows are one of the most important aspects of your brick-and-mortar business. You can enhance them in many ways that will help you bring in more customers and revenue.

You can use your windows to show off some of your products. Make sure you display the most popular items in a place where they are easily accessible by customers and easy to find, like the front window. And if people don’t know what they want when they walk in, this is a great way for them to see what’s available and decide to purchase once they’re inside.

You can also use your window displays as a way to attract people to your store. Make sure you have an appealing display that will grab the attention of possible customers who are driving or walking by. This will entice them to stop and look at what’s in your windows, and, hopefully, stop and come inside.
